Thinking of resigning as ITFC boss after 15 years of unprecedented success. on 08:48 - Sep 11 with 686 views | SonOfSpock | Quite enjoyed managing AZ Alkmaar for a number of seasons. You dont start off with a great transfer kitty, but youth system is excellent and this helps genereate some income for transfers. Was consistently in Europe but always just fell shy of being able to compete with the big boys of the competition and likewise hold onto my stars when bigger clubs came, alas. | | | |
